East Mersea bus and lorry crash injures 18

. Firefighters have been called to an RTC involving a single decker bus and a HGV which was carrying a steam traction engine. The steam traction engine fell from the lorry and onto the bus trapping and injuring a number of passengers. One critically injured man has been flown to the Royal London Hospital, four patients have been taken to Colchester Hospital with serious but non- life-threatening injuries. Eleven patients have been taken to both Colchester and Broomfield hospitals with various minor injuries, and two patients were treated and discharged at the scene. Crews used specialist cutting equipment to release two casulaties trapped. Both were left in the care of the Ambulance Service. There are a number people injured at this incident, believed to be around 30 people, who are all in the care of the Ambulance Service.
